November 7, 2014

Five Smartphone Trends That May Change The Filipino Real Estate Market In 2015

| 0 comments |

The rise of smartphones will change the real estate game is played in the Philippines in 2015. It goes without saying that the Philippines’ mobile Internet landscape is fast evolving. Smartphone penetration, although relatively low at 15 percent, has been growing over the last couple of years. It is expected to leap to 50 percent in 2015.
